The most common diagnostic tool is the OBD reader. OBD refers to On-Board Diagnostics, a mechanism that monitors your car’s operation and informs you when something is identified.

Contemporary cars use OBD2, the newer standard of this protocol, which was established in the late 20th century. OBD2 readers can interface with your automobile’s ECU to access fault codes when the warning light illuminates. https://carcodereader.store/

These scanners range from entry-level code readers to advanced diagnostic systems with extensive capabilities. Simple code readers generally show the DTC and a brief definition, while high-end scanners offer detailed information and additional features.

Bluetooth OBD2 readers have gained favor in the last years. These tools pair to your phone or iPad via wireless technology, enabling you to employ a specialized app to retrieve and decode diagnostic data.

Cable-connected diagnostic tools, on the other hand, link directly to your car’s OBD2 connector without necessitating a separate tool. These typically provide more consistent communication and don’t require a power source to work.

When the MIL lights up, it’s suggested to employ a OBD tool to determine the reason of the alert. This can help you decide whether the concern requires urgent repair or can be delayed until your next scheduled service.

Once fixing the actual issue, you should clear the error codes to turn off the check engine light and permit the system to monitor if the fault has been successfully fixed.

Sophisticated diagnostic tools can obtain real-time data from various systems in your car, including engine speed, fuel trim, engine temperature, O2 sensor data, and various other parameters.

This real-time information is extremely valuable for troubleshooting occasional issues that may not set a steady error code but still influence car operation.

Interpreting fault codes demands some understanding with vehicle systems. The fault indicators are typically formatted with a letter followed by several numerals. The initial digit shows the area involved:

– “P” stands for Powertrain

– “B” indicates Comfort Systems

– “C” indicates Underbody Systems

– “U” indicates Integration Systems

The following digit shows whether the code is universal (0) or proprietary (1). The last numbers specify the exact problem found.
